// Code generated by msgraph-generate.go DO NOT EDIT.
package msgraph
import "context"
//
type WorkbookFunctionsIsErrRequestBuilder struct{ BaseRequestBuilder }
// IsErr action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sErr(reqObj *WorkbookFunctionsIsErrRequestParameter) *WorkbookFunctionsIsErrRequestBuilder {
bb := &WorkbookFunctionsIsErrR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isErr"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sErrR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sErrRequestBuilder) Request() *WorkbookFunctionsIsErrRequest {
return &WorkbookFunctionsIsErrR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sErrR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sErrorRequestBuilder struct{ BaseRequestBuilder }
// IsError action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sError(reqObj *WorkbookFunctionsIsErrorRequestParameter) *WorkbookFunctionsIsErrorRequestBuilder {
bb := &WorkbookFunctionsIsErrorR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isError"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sErrorR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sErrorRequestBuilder) Request() *WorkbookFunctionsIsErrorRequest {
return &WorkbookFunctionsIsErrorR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sErrorR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sEvenRequestBuilder struct{ BaseRequestBuilder }
// IsEven action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sEven(reqObj *WorkbookFunctionsIsEvenRequestParameter) *WorkbookFunctionsIsEvenRequestBuilder {
bb := &WorkbookFunctionsIsEvenR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isEven"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sEvenR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sEvenRequestBuilder) Request() *WorkbookFunctionsIsEvenRequest {
return &WorkbookFunctionsIsEvenR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sEvenR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sFormulaRequestBuilder struct{ BaseRequestBuilder }
// IsFormula action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sFormula(reqObj *WorkbookFunctionsIsFormulaRequestParameter) *WorkbookFunctionsIsFormulaRequestBuilder {
bb := &WorkbookFunctionsIsFormulaR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isFormula"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sFormulaR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sFormulaRequestBuilder) Request() *WorkbookFunctionsIsFormulaRequest {
return &WorkbookFunctionsIsFormulaR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sFormulaR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sLogicalRequestBuilder struct{ BaseRequestBuilder }
// IsLogical action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sLogical(reqObj *WorkbookFunctionsIsLogicalRequestParameter) *WorkbookFunctionsIsLogicalRequestBuilder {
bb := &WorkbookFunctionsIsLogicalR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isLogical"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sLogicalR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sLogicalRequestBuilder) Request() *WorkbookFunctionsIsLogicalRequest {
return &WorkbookFunctionsIsLogicalR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sLogicalR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sNARequestBuilder struct{ BaseRequestBuilder }
// IsNA action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sNA(reqObj *WorkbookFunctionsIsNARequestParameter) *WorkbookFunctionsIsNARequestBuilder {
bb := &WorkbookFunctionsIsNARequ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isNA"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sNARequ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sNARequestBuilder) Request() *WorkbookFunctionsIsNARequest {
return &WorkbookFunctionsIsNARequ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sNARequ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sNonTextRequestBuilder struct{ BaseRequestBuilder }
// IsNonText action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sNonText(reqObj *WorkbookFunctionsIsNonTextRequestParameter) *WorkbookFunctionsIsNonTextRequestBuilder {
bb := &WorkbookFunctionsIsNonTextR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isNonText"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sNonTextR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sNonTextRequestBuilder) Request() *WorkbookFunctionsIsNonTextRequest {
return &WorkbookFunctionsIsNonTextR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sNonTextR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sNumberRequestBuilder struct{ BaseRequestBuilder }
// IsNumber action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sNumber(reqObj *WorkbookFunctionsIsNumberRequestParameter) *WorkbookFunctionsIsNumberRequestBuilder {
bb := &WorkbookFunctionsIsNumberR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isNumber"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sNumberR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sNumberRequestBuilder) Request() *WorkbookFunctionsIsNumberRequest {
return &WorkbookFunctionsIsNumberR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sNumberR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sOddRequestBuilder struct{ BaseRequestBuilder }
// IsOdd action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sOdd(reqObj *WorkbookFunctionsIsOddRequestParameter) *WorkbookFunctionsIsOddRequestBuilder {
bb := &WorkbookFunctionsIsOddR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isOdd"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sOddR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sOddRequestBuilder) Request() *WorkbookFunctionsIsOddRequest {
return &WorkbookFunctionsIsOddR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sOddR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}
//
type WorkbookFunctionsIsTextRequestBuilder struct{ BaseRequestBuilder }
// IsText action undocumented
func (b *WorkbookFunctionsRequestBuilder) IsText(reqObj *WorkbookFunctionsIsTextRequestParameter) *WorkbookFunctionsIsTextRequestBuilder {
bb := &WorkbookFunctionsIsTextRequestBuilder{BaseRequestBuilder: b.BaseRequestBuilder}
bb.BaseRequestBuilder.baseURL += "/isText"
bb.BaseRequestBuilder.requestObject = reqObj
return bb
}
//
type WorkbookFunctionsIsTextRequest struct{ BaseRequest }
//
func (b *WorkbookFunctionsIsTextRequestBuilder) Request() *WorkbookFunctionsIsTextRequest {
return &WorkbookFunctionsIsTextRequest{
BaseRequest: BaseRequest{baseURL: b.baseURL, client: b.client, requestObject: b.requestObject},
}
}
//
func (r *WorkbookFunctionsIsTextRequest) Post(ctx context.Context) (resObj *WorkbookFunctionResult, err error) {
err = r.JSONRequest(ctx, "POST", "", r.requestObject, &resObj)
return
}